Tom Robinson, although obviously innocent, has been found guilty of raping Mayella Ewell. It is clear that Tom has been discriminated against on racial grounds, and is, therefore, convicted.

Miss Maudie discusses this situation, and points out that ''Atticus Finch won’t win, he can’t win, but he’s the only man in these parts who can keep a jury out so long in a case like that. And I thought to myself, well, we’re making a step—it’s just a baby-step, but it’s a step.''

Although an innocent man has been convicted, at least the case lasted for a longer period of time than usually - there was some resistance. The prejudices against black people will not be eliminated over night, but this is a slight indicator that people are gradually changing their attitude.

William Shakespeare's tragedy play "Julius Caesar" tells how the title character was murdered for the 'safety of Rome and its people' by people close to him. The conspirators included Brutus and Cassius, who felt that Rome is better off without the over ambitious Caesar.

The lines "Scorning the base/ By which he did ascend" best supports the theme that power can corrupt people. These lines were spoken by Brutus in Act II scene i of the play where he's shown debating between his dilemma of participating and supporting the murder plan of Caesar or not. By these words, he meant to imply that once people are ambitious, they will do anything to get their goal, even humbling themselves. But, once they get their goal, they turned their backs on those who helped them achieve and tries to gain higher ground while despising and scorning those behind his success. This greed blinded him and let him see only things for himself. Thus is the same case for Caesar. Brutus opines that even though Caesar may be a good leader now, but once he gains more power and become king will be bad for Rome. Thus, the decision to kill him.

Independent Clause:

An independent clause can stand on its own, offering full meaning. There is no need to join any other clause. An independent clause can also be as short as just two words e.g He smiled. So presence of object is not mandatory in an independent clause.

Jane ran to the store is independent clause because it has all the three components of an independent clause i.e

1 Has a subject - Jane

2 has an action or predicate - ran to the store (a predicate)

3 Expresses a complete thought

Subordinate Clause:

It does not express a complete thought.

e.g Because he likes stories.

A clause becomes subordinate because of;

1: The presence of marker words (e.g Before, after, because, since, in order   to, although, though, whenever, wherever, whether, while, even though, even if)

2: Conjunction (And, or, nor, but, yet)

Subordinate/dependent clause MUST be joined to another clause to make the meaning clear.

Final answer:

Option B is correct because it properly uses a semicolon to join two related independent clauses without creating a comma splice or needing an additional conjunction.

Explanation:

The correct choice that displays proper punctuation among the given options is option B) We were a long way from our destination; we stopped at a motel for the night. This sentence correctly uses a semicolon to join two related independent clauses. The use of the semicolon indicates that the second clause is closely related to the first and provides a pause that is stronger than a comma but not as final as a period. Options A and C contain comma splices, which are incorrect because they use a comma to join two independent clauses without a coordinating conjunction. Option D is not incorrect, but it is a stylistic choice to include 'so' with a semicolon, which is not necessary when the semicolon alone can join the clauses.
